The Centre Ministry of Housing and Urban Affairs has approved the next phase of the Pune Metro, involving an investment of Rs 910.18 crore. The second phase aims to extend the metro rail by 4.413 km from Pimpri-Chinchwad Municipal Corporation station to Nigdi, with three elevated stations.
